A garage floor endures heavy traffic. Over time, it can become damaged, impacting both the appearance of your garage and its overall durability. Thankfully, a durable floor coating can significantly transform your garage, making it more attractive and durable to the rigors of daily life.

A quality coating provides a uniform surface that's easy to clean. It also provides protection against spills, and can even help reduce noise.

With numerous colors and finishes available, you can personalize your garage floor to seamlessly match your preference. A durable floor coating is a intelligent investment that can upgrade the value and appeal of your home.

Get an Affordable Garage Floor Coating Without Breaking the Bank

Want a garage floor that seems great and can withstand the wear of everyday life? A professional application can do wonders, but it can also price a pretty penny. The good news is you don't have to forgo quality for affordability. With a bit research and effort, you can discover an affordable garage floor coating that won't burden your budget. Check out are several tips to help you get started:

* First clarifying the size of your garage floor. This will help you in estimating the amount of coating required.

* Next, compare prices from here different providers. Don't be afraid to request for quotes from multiple companies to guarantee you're getting the best deal.

* Evaluate a DIY approach. While a professional placement may be ideal, it can also be costly. If you're proficient, you may be able to save money by installing the coating yourself.

* Last but not least, look for deals. Many companies offer special offers on their garage floor coatings, especially during peak periods.

By following these tips, you can locate an affordable garage floor coating that will revamp your garage space without shattering the bank.
